Lessons from Monero and Tornado Cash

Monero: Privacy-by-Default Pioneer. Monero set the standard for on-chain privacy by making every transaction anonymous by default. It uses a three-pronged strategy — ring signatures, stealth addresses, and RingCT (Ring Confidential Transactions) — to hide sender identities, recipient addresses, and transaction amounts . Stealth addresses ensure only the sender and receiver can know where funds went, obscuring the payee’s actual address on the public ledger . Ring signatures blend each transaction’s inputs with decoys, obscuring the true sender among a crowd . And RingCT (augmented by Bulletproofs range proofs) hides the amounts being sent while still allowing the network to verify balances. The result is a high level of anonymity for every Monero user. However, this robust privacy comes with drawbacks. Monero’s heavy cryptography makes transactions larger and the network throughput lower than non-private chains. Its focus on privacy also raised red flags for regulators — major exchanges have delisted Monero, and countries like Japan and South Korea outright banned it due to concerns over illicit use . In short, Monero offers strong privacy but isn’t very speed- or regulator-friendly.

Tornado Cash: Anonymity Pools Under Fire. Tornado Cash approached the privacy challenge differently, not as a standalone coin but as a non-custodial mixer for platforms like Ethereum. Using clever zk-SNARK zero-knowledge proofs, Tornado Cash allows users to deposit cryptocurrency into a smart contract and later withdraw to a new address with no on-chain link to the depositor. This effectively “breaks” the blockchain trail and provides strong anonymity for those funds. Importantly, no central party controls the mixing; it’s enforced by smart contracts and cryptography. This method proved effective — in fact, too effective for some authorities. In 2022 the U.S. Treasury’s OFAC sanctioned Tornado Cash, alleging it helped launder over $7 billion in crypto (including $455M from North Korea’s Lazarus hackers) by obfuscating transactions . The service’s association with high-profile hacks brought intense scrutiny. Beyond regulatory issues, Tornado Cash had practical limitations: it required users to transact in fixed denominations for maximum privacy, which could be inconvenient and inflexible . It also relies on the underlying network (Ethereum) for speed and fees — meaning at times users paid high gas fees and waited for relatively slow block confirmations. Tornado provided an opt-in anonymity boost for those who needed it, but it wasn’t a comprehensive solution for everyday private transactions.

Enter Privatus: Privacy and Performance Without Compromise

Privatus is an emerging Web3 blockchain that promises to marry the anonymity of Monero with the speed of Solana, adding its own twist to stay on the right side of regulators. In development as a confidential blockchain, Privatus explicitly draws inspiration from the privacy all-stars: Monero, Zcash, and Tornado Cash, while leveraging the high-throughput designs of Solana. The core idea is bold: unmatched transaction privacy plus lightning-fast throughput on one platform . Privatus achieves this by fusing multiple state-of-the-art technologies in a layered approach:

• Stealth Addresses: Every Privatus transaction can use stealth addresses to hide the actual destination wallet. This means the public blockchain only sees one-time proxy addresses, not the recipient’s real address, ensuring payer/payee anonymity . Even if you share your public address, outsiders cannot easily link incoming payments to you, much like Monero’s stealth address system.

• Ring Signatures: To protect sender identities, Privatus implements ring signatures (akin to Monero’s rings) that mix each signing key with a group of decoys. Any given transaction’s origin is untraceable, since an observer cannot distinguish which of the “ring” members actually signed it . This makes it computationally infeasible to pinpoint the true sender among a crowd of possible signers, vastly enhancing anonymity for the person initiating a transfer.

• zk-SNARKs: Privatus is in the process of integrating zk-SNARK proofs — the cutting-edge cryptography also used in Zcash and Tornado — to enable shielded transactions and anonymous pools. zk-SNARKs allow certain transaction details to be verified without revealing any actual data . In Privatus, this means users can prove a transaction is valid (and even compliant with rules) while keeping amounts, addresses, or other metadata completely confidential. This tech powers features like shielded addresses (hiding all details of a transaction on-chain) and trustless mixers. It’s the same class of technology that enables Tornado’s unlinkability, now deployed within Privatus’s own network.

Combining multiple privacy technologies, Privatus fuses Monero-level confidentiality, Zcash-grade zero-knowledge proofs, and Tornado Cash-style mixing with Solana-like speed and throughput . The result is a blockchain that can obscure senders, recipients, and amounts at will, without slowing down transactions.

• Solana-Grade Speed: Under the hood, Privatus uses a high-performance architecture with a hybrid Proof-of-Stake + Delegated PoS consensus to achieve Solana-level throughput. The network reportedly supports up to 50,000 transactions per second and near-instant finality . Transactions cost only a fraction of a cent (on the order of $0.001) in fees . This places Privatus in elite company performance-wise, rivaling traditional financial networks and outpacing older privacy coins by orders of magnitude. In short, privacy features won’t bog down this blockchain.

• Confidential Smart Contracts: Unlike Monero, which is primarily a payment coin, Privatus is a full platform supporting smart contracts that operate privately. Developers will be able to build confidential DeFi applications and dApps on Privatus, with contract state and logic hidden on-chain . This opens the door to things like private lending, anonymous voting systems, and hidden asset swaps — functionality that neither Monero nor Tornado Cash (as a standalone mixer) could offer. Cross-chain bridges are also in the works, so assets can move into Privatus for privacy and back out to other networks as needed . This focus on a broader ecosystem appeals to developers who want both privacy and composability.

Regulatory-Friendly Privacy: User Choice and Compliance

Perhaps the most innovative aspect of Privatus is its two-tiered approach to privacy, designed to balance anonymity with regulatory compliance. Users can choose between making a normal private transaction or opting into full anonymity via an on-chain mixer, depending on their needs and risk tolerance. By default, Privatus transactions can be opaque to the public yet still auditable in a controlled way. For instance, users may have the option to share “view keys” or utilize a transparent mode for specific transactions — useful for compliance, audits, or interacting with regulated entities. This Compliance Mode essentially allows transactions on Privatus to be viewable (if the user consents) similar to regular public blockchain transactions . In normal operation, your activity is private, but you retain the ability to prove your transactions or make them visible when necessary (for example, to comply with an exchange’s requirements or tax laws).

For those who demand maximum anonymity, Privatus offers an “Anonymous Pool” feature — an opt-in pooling mechanism inspired by Tornado Cash’s model. If a user is willing to pay a small extra fee, they can send their funds into an anonymity pool that breaks all links between sender and receiver addresses, providing full unlinkability . This advanced privacy option uses zk-SNARKs under the hood (a cryptographic mixer within the blockchain) to mix coins among many participants. After a delay, the coins emerge to the target address with no traceable connection to the original sender. Because this mode is resource-intensive and provides the highest level of secrecy, it incurs a premium fee — a portion of which is fed back into the network for sustainability.

Privatus introduces a dual-mode privacy model. Users can operate in a transparent or semi-transparent mode for routine transactions (aiding compliance and audits), or contribute to an anonymous pool for complete privacy. Importantly, fully anonymous transactions carry a small extra fee, which is returned to the ecosystem via the PVS token economy . This approach gives users control over their privacy level while ensuring privacy features are sustainably funded.

By monetizing the “premium” anonymous transactions, Privatus creates tokenomic incentives around privacy. The native PVS token is used to pay these fees, and those fees can be redistributed to stakers and validators who support the network . In essence, when you choose to send a fully anonymous transaction, you are also contributing to the network’s security and development funding. This is a clever twist: privacy is not just a feature, but also a service that fuels the ecosystem. The PVS token additionally powers governance (one token, one vote in the project’s DAO) and rewards participants who help run the blockchain . For investors, this means the token has multiple utility pillars — from transaction fees to staking to governance — potentially driving demand as the platform gains users seeking privacy. For regulators, Privatus can argue that it provides accountability by design (through optional transparency and on-demand auditability) rather than blanket secrecy.
